HINT:

  • Use the same procedure for the RH side and LH side.
  • The following procedure is for the LH side.

PROCEDURE

1. SEPARATE REAR COMBINATION LIGHT ASSEMBLY

*a

Pin

*b

Guide

Remove in this Direction

-

-

(1) Apply protective tape around the rear combination light assembly as shown in the illustration.

(2) Remove the 2 screws.

(3) Disengage the pin and guide to separate the rear combination light assembly as shown in the illustration.

2. REMOVE REAR SIDE MARKER LIGHT SOCKET

Remove in this Direction

-

-

3. REMOVE REAR SIDE MARKER LIGHT BULB
